Solution:[br]
Restore iPhone. Means a complete wipeout, different from the usual reset or erase. Doing that and restoring a Finder Mac iTunes backup will bring back issue still.

Thereafter, restore from iCloud backup. The only way forward. And do not let your battery drop below 20% anymore.

After I did the above, the issue went away. Just hours ago, when I inevitably had to drop the battery below 20% because I did not have my charger, the issue has come back. Hence as follows.
